  3. Christopher Butler (born May 22, 1949) is an American musician, writer, and artist who is best known for leading the 1980s new wave band The Waitresses. His notable songs include " I Know What Boys Like ", "No Guilt", " Christmas Wrapping " [1] and the theme song for the TV sitcom Square Pegs .
